Abstract
The consistent description of the nuclear response at low and high momentum transfer requires a unified dynamical model, suitable to account for both short- and long-range correlation effects. We report the results of a study of the charged current weak response of symmetric nuclear matter, carried out using an effective interaction obtained from a realistic model of the nucleon-nucleon force within the formalism of correlated basis functions. Our approach allows for a clear identification of the kinematical regions in which different interaction effects dominate.
